A piece of a glacier breaks off in the Dolomites, taking several mountaineers with it on the way down to the valley. At least six people are killed. The accident is likely to be related to the drought and heat in the country.
(dpa)/pop./cov. With brutal thunder, masses of ice, snow and rocks fall from a glacier in northern Italy into the valley. They drag mountaineers with them, some to their deaths. At least six people died in the massive glacier fall on the Marmolada, the highest mountain in the Dolomites, on Sunday, as a spokeswoman for the Veneto region’s rescue control center confirmed on request.
